Python3 and MongoDB using Docker

Dockerfile for Python3 and MongoDB using Ubuntu
FROM ubuntu:16.04
MAINTAINER www.shubhamdipt.com
# Install MongoDB.
RUN apt-key adv --keyserver hkp://keyserver.ubuntu.com:80 --recv EA312927 && \
echo 'deb http://repo.mongodb.org/apt/ubuntu trusty/mongodb-org/3.2 multiverse' > /etc/apt/sources.list.d/mongodb-org-3.2.list
RUN apt-get -y update \
&& apt-get install -y --allow-unauthenticated mongodb-org \
&& apt-get install -y git vim wget python3-pip python3-dev \
&& cd /usr/local/bin \
&& ln -s /usr/bin/python3 python \
&& pip3 install --upgrade pip
RUN apt-get clean
# Define mountable directories.
VOLUME ["/data/db"]
ADD . /data
WORKDIR /data
RUN pip install -r requirements.txt
ENV PYTHONPATH='.'
EXPOSE 5000
RUN chmod +x ./start.sh
CMD ["./start.sh"]
and in the start.sh file add the following:
#!/usr/bin/env bash
set -eu
echo "Starting MONGOD and Flask App ...."
mongod & python3 app.py
and in the docker-compose.yml:
version: '2'
services:
web:
build: .
ports:
- "5000:5000"
